首页 > 编程笔记 > Java笔记

JSP JSTL <fmt:setTimeZone>标签:格式化时区

<fmt:setTimeZone> 标签用于设置默认时区,也可以将设置的时区存储在 scope 属性指定范围的变量中。

语法:

<fmt:setTimeZone value="timeZone"
  [var="varName"]
  [scope="{page|request|session|application}"]/>


<fmt:setTimeZone> 标签各属性的详细介绍如表所示。

<fmt:setTimeZone>标签属性
属性 类型 描述 引用 EL
value String,java.util.TimeZone 指定的时区 可以
var String 存储时区的变量 不可以
scope String 变量的存取范围 不可以

示例

应用 <fmt:setTimeZone> 标签设置默认时区为 GMT(格林尼治时间),关键代码如下:
<%@taglib prefix="fmt" uri="http://java.sun.com/jsp/jstl/fmt"%>
  <fmt:setTimeZone value="GMT" scope="session"/>
  <fmt:parseDate value="2008-11-29" var="dateTime"/>
  <br>
    ${dateTime}

所有教程

优秀文章